Cookies are small pieces of data stored on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website, which allow the website to recognise your device on subsequent visits.
They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ently, as well as to provide information to the owners of the site.

Performance cookies collect information about how visitors use a website, for instance, which pages visitors go to most often, and if they get error messages from web pages.
These cookies do not collect information that identifies a visitor; all information these cookies collect is aggregated and therefore anonymous.
They are used only to improve how a website works and to understand user behaviour.
Functionality cookies allow the website to remember choices you make and provide more enhanced, personal features.
For example, a website may be able to provide you with local weather reports or traffic news by storing in a cookie the region in which you are currently located.
These cookies can also be used to remember changes you have made to text size, fonts and other parts of web pages that you can customise.
